About Bahar Ganja Village
Bahar Ganja is a large village in Khejuri I tehsil, in the district of Purba Medinipur, West Bengal.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 2,341, made up of 1,237 males and 1,104 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 892 females per 1000 males. The village covers 457.18 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 721432,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Bahar Ganja
The census records public bus service for Bahar Ganja as Available within 10+ km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
